This is a print of my sold original, up-cycled oil painting that is inspired by the 2005 adaptation of Pride & Prejudice, written by Jane Austen. It is from the best scene ever in the history of cinema & If I am not getting proposed to by a man walking across a field at dawn then what is the point. I wanted to encapsulate this moment that holds so many words, even when so few are said. It features my interpretation of Mr. Darcy walking through the misty morning field to find Elizabeth Bennet. This print comes in 5 sizes. 8 x 12in / 20.3 x 30.5 cm 11 x 14in / 27.9 x 35.6 cm 16 x 20in / 40.6 x 50.8 cm 20 x 28in / 50.8 x 71.1 cm 24 x 36in / 61.0 x 91.4cm Frame is not included.
